About Kothara Village

Kothara is a mid sized village in Mathura tehsil, in the district of Mathura, Uttar Pradesh. The Census of India 2011 recorded a population of 1,889, made up of 1,012 males and 877 females. That works out to a sex ratio of about 867 females per 1000 males. The village covers 259.5 hectares hectares.
